Evaluation

My magazine is similar to that of other sixth form magazines. However, I wanted it to look individual to Fortismere. My front cover layout follows the same conventions of many other college/school magazines, using a picture of students on a school trip. The image is of students at the school, i chose this image because it makes the magazine seem more personal and focused on their sixth form. I edited the image my making it black and white, increasing the contrast, darkening it and finally cropping it. Other magazines seemed to keep their images fairly the same, keeping them the same bright colours, I chose to change my image to make the front cover seem more professional. Most sixth form magazines didn't seem to have manipulated their image as most of the images were of the school buildings.

My magazine is a winter/Christmas issue, with this in mind I used this as an overall theme for the design of the magazine. I found an image of a snow flake and copied this onto the front cover and scattered them in different place to add to the winter theme. However i didn't want to crowd the front cover with too many images or text.

My magazine is aimed at students, so i decided to make it geared towards today's youth. I used bright colours, grabbing text and eye catching images. Although, i wanted to show a fun, youthful image and design i also wanted to show students enjoying working, in this case showing students on a trip.

The magazine would be published by a local company to save money, and be on sale in the sixth from block at lunch time. The magazine would cost £1 and would include the weekly newsletter. I decided to keep the cost low to attract more people to buy it and spend any extra money on competition prizes. The magazine would also be accessible to teachers and parents, as the magazine would feature information about school events and news. Knowing that teachers and parents would read the magazine i would include information that would concern them.
